DORM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

234 of the 5,075 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Dorman Products (DORM)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$2.04B — down 6.4% from $2.18B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 29 funds opened new DORM positions and 15 closed out — a net gain of 14 holders — while 68 added to existing stakes and 89 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Anchor Capital Advisors, adding an estimated $24.9M. The largest seller was Ameriprise, cutting an estimated $34.3M.
